Why Game Information Matters
Game labels alone do not reveal the full playing experience. Volatility indicates how frequently and dramatically a game may pay, while the return-to-player percentage describes a long-term theoretical figure rather than a personal guarantee. Reading the paytable and feature guide helps players understand symbols, bonus mechanics, paylines, and wagering requirements.
Bonuses, Promotions, and Wagering Conditions
Welcome offers can add value, although the headline amount should never be the only deciding factor. Promotional terms may specify a minimum deposit, eligible games, maximum bet rules, expiry dates, wagering multipliers, and maximum withdrawal limits. Some bonuses apply only to selected payment methods or require a verification step before funds can be withdrawn.
- Confirm the minimum deposit needed to activate an offer.
- Read the wagering requirement and identify which balances it applies to.
- Check whether casino games contribute at different rates.
- Look for restrictions on maximum stake size during bonus play.
- Note the promotion’s expiry date and any withdrawal cap.
A useful habit is to calculate the total wagering obligation before accepting a promotion. If a bonus of $50 carries a 30x requirement, the relevant turnover could be $1,500, depending on the stated terms. Understanding this figure makes comparisons more realistic and reduces avoidable surprises.
Deposits, Withdrawals, and Account Security
Payment convenience matters particularly for Australian users who want familiar banking options and transparent transaction processing. Review the available cards, e-wallets, bank transfer services, and alternative methods. Each option may have different minimums, fees, verification requirements, and expected processing times.
Withdrawals commonly require identity verification. A casino may request a government-issued document, proof of address, or confirmation of payment ownership. This process supports anti-fraud controls and should be completed through secure account channels. Never send sensitive documents through an unverified contact or disclose passwords to support staff.
Simple Security Measures
- Use a unique password that is not shared with other websites.
- Enable two-factor authentication if the platform provides it.
- Check that the connection is secure before entering payment details.
- Keep account emails and verification messages private.
- Contact support quickly if an unfamiliar transaction appears.
Responsible Play for a Sustainable Experience
Online casino entertainment should remain affordable and controlled. Set a spending limit before playing, decide how long a session will last, and avoid chasing losses. Deposits should come from disposable funds rather than money reserved for rent, bills, or essential expenses.
Useful control tools may include deposit limits, session reminders, cooling-off periods, and self-exclusion. Players who notice repeated difficulty stopping should take a break and seek independent support. Gambling is not a method of earning income, and no strategy can remove the underlying risk of losing money.
